Use of ‘Cookies’

A cookie is a small piece of information sent by a web server to a web browser, which enables the server to collect information from the browser. Find out more about the ‘Use of Cookies’ on http://www.cookiecentral.com

Personal Data is processed according to the data protection principles.

These are:

  • Collected only for specific legitimate purposes.
  • Adequate, relevant and limited to what is necessary
  • Processed lawfully, fairly and transparently.
  • We ensure appropriate security, integrity and confidentiality.
  • Stored only for as long as is necessary.
